Bitstarz stands as a pioneering force in the cryptocurrency casino space, blending a vast traditional game library with innovative crypto-native features. This whitepaper provides a comprehensive technical and operational dissection of the platform, designed for users seeking to understand its underlying mechanics, optimize their strategy, and navigate all potential scenarios. We will move beyond surface-level review to examine app architecture, calculate the true cost of bonuses, and detail security infrastructure.
Before You Start: The Prerequisite Checklist
Engaging with a platform of Bitstarz’s complexity requires preparation. Ensure you meet these prerequisites to guarantee a smooth operational experience.
- Jurisdiction Verification: Confirm that online gambling and the use of cryptocurrencies are legal in your country of residence. Bitstarz holds a Curacao eGaming license, but local laws supersede.
- Wallet Preparedness: For optimal functionality, prepare a self-custody cryptocurrency wallet (e.g., MetaMask, Trust Wallet) with funds. While fiat is accepted, the platform’s core efficiency lies in crypto transactions.
- Documentation: Have a valid government-issued ID (passport, driver’s license) and a recent proof of address (utility bill, bank statement) ready for the KYC (Know Your Customer) verification process, which may be triggered by withdrawals.
- Security Setup: Decide on and prepare a unique, strong password for your account. Consider using a password manager. Ensure your email account is secure, as it will be the primary recovery method.
- Connection Stability: A stable, high-speed internet connection is crucial, especially for live dealer games and uninterrupted bitstarz login sessions.

Account Registration: A Protocol Walkthrough
The registration process establishes your digital identity on the platform. Following these steps precisely minimizes future authentication issues.
- Initiation: Navigate to the official Bitstarz website and click the “Sign Up” button, typically located in the top-right corner.
- Data Entry: Fill in the required fields: email address, a secure password, preferred currency (selecting a cryptocurrency like BTC or ETH will streamline future transactions), and any promotional code if applicable.
- Agreement & Creation: Carefully read the Terms & Conditions and Privacy Policy. Check the boxes to confirm you are of legal age and agree to the documents. Submit the form.
- Verification: Immediately check your email inbox for a verification message from Bitstarz. Click the confirmation link to activate your account. This step is mandatory to prevent lockouts.
Deep Dive: The Bitstarz App Architecture & Installation
The bitstarz app is not a native application downloaded from iOS or Android stores, but a Progressive Web App (PWA). This architectural decision has significant implications for performance, updates, and accessibility.
- Technology: As a PWA, it runs within your mobile browser (Chrome, Safari) but can be installed to function like a native app, with a home screen icon and dedicated window.
- Installation Protocol (Android):
- Visit the Bitstarz site via your Chrome browser.
- Tap the browser’s menu (three dots) and select “Add to Home screen” or “Install app.”
- Confirm the installation. An icon will be created on your home screen.
- Installation Protocol (iOS):
- Visit the site via Safari.
- Tap the “Share” icon (square with arrow).
- Scroll down and select “Add to Home Screen.” Rename if desired and tap “Add.”
- Advantages: No app store restrictions, immediate updates (no manual downloads), smaller storage footprint, and uniform performance across platforms.
- Considerations: Performance is partially dependent on browser engine optimization. Ensure your browser is updated to the latest version.
Bonus Mathematics & Strategy: Calculating Real Cost and Value
Bonuses are not “free money.” They are contracts with specific financial conditions, primarily the Wagering Requirement (WR). Understanding the math is crucial to determining if a bonus is +EV (Expected Value).
Scenario: You claim a $100 bonus with a 40x wagering requirement on a deposit of $50.
- Total Bonus Money: $100
- Wagering Requirement (WR): 40x
- Total Turnover Required: $100 * 40 = $4,000
This $4,000 must be wagered on eligible games. Different game types contribute different percentages to the WR (e.g., slots 100%, table games 10%).
Expected Loss Calculation: To estimate the real cost, you must factor in the game’s House Edge (RTP – 100%).
- Assume: You play a slot with a 96% RTP (a 4% house edge).
- Expected Loss on Turnover: $4,000 * 0.04 = $160.
Analysis: You received $100 in bonus funds, but the expected loss from meeting the WR is $160. Therefore, the expected net cost of accepting this bonus is -$60. This demonstrates a -EV proposition under these specific conditions.
Strategic Application: Bonuses can become +EV under specific circumstances: if the bonus amount is very high relative to the WR, if you play games with a very low house edge (like blackjack with perfect strategy, though often restricted), or during promotions with “sticky” bonuses that do not contribute to the WR. Always calculate Expected Cost = (WR * House Edge) – Bonus Amount.
| Category | Specification / Metric | Operational Impact |
|---|---|---|
| Licensing & Regulation | Curacao eGaming (Master License 365/JAZ) | Standard international oversight; mandates KYC procedures. |
| Core Technology | Progressive Web App (PWA) for mobile | No app store dependency; fast, responsive updates; cross-platform. |
| Transaction Speeds (Crypto) | Deposits: Instant | Withdrawals: 0-10 minutes (network dependent) | Near-instant settlement eliminates traditional banking delays. |
| Game Provably Fair System | Client Seed, Server Seed, Nonce cryptographic verification | Allows players to independently audit the fairness of each game round. |
| Game Providers | 50+ (NetEnt, Pragmatic Play, Evolution, BGaming, etc.) | Extensive, varied library ensuring high quality and innovation. |
| Supported Cryptocurrencies | Bitcoin (BTC), Ethereum (ETH), Litecoin (LTC), Dogecoin (DOGE), 4+ others | Flexibility in asset choice for deposits and withdrawals. |
Banking Analysis: Transaction Protocols & Limits
Bitstarz operates a dual-system banking framework: traditional fiat processing and decentralized crypto settlement.
- Crypto Protocol:
- Deposit: Generate a unique deposit address/wallet QR code in your account. Send funds from your external wallet. Confirmation time depends on blockchain network congestion (usually 1-3 block confirmations).
- Withdrawal: Request withdrawal to your external crypto wallet address. Bitstarz processes batches rapidly, often within minutes. The funds then travel on the blockchain.
Advantage: Anonymity in transaction, speed, low to no fees from the casino (miner/network fees still apply).
- Fiat Protocol: Utilizes standard payment processors (credit cards, e-wallets). Subject to standard banking delays (1-3 business days for deposits, 1-5 for withdrawals), potential fees, and mandatory KYC.
- Limit Architecture: Withdrawal limits vary. Crypto limits are typically higher (e.g., several BTC equivalent per month) with lower minimums (~0.0001 BTC). Fiat limits are structured by method. Always check the “Banking” page for current, precise limits.
Security & Privacy Protocols
Bitstarz implements a multi-layered security stack to protect user data and funds.
- Data Encryption: All data transmission is secured via TLS 1.2+ (Transport Layer Security), encrypting communication between your device and their servers.
- Fund Segregation: Player funds are held in separate accounts from operational funds, a standard but critical practice for financial security.
- Two-Factor Authentication (2FA): Available as an optional but highly recommended layer for the bitstarz login process. This adds a time-based one-time password (TOTP) from an app like Google Authenticator.
- Provably Fair Gaming: For their in-house and some third-party games, a cryptographic system allows you to verify each bet’s fairness post-game, ensuring the outcome was not manipulated.
- Privacy: As a crypto-friendly site, it collects minimal transactional data for crypto users. Fiat transactions require sharing data with payment processors.
Technical Troubleshooting: Common Failure Scenarios
Diagnosing and resolving common technical issues is a key user skill.
- Scenario 1: Bitstarz login Failure.
- Symptom: “Invalid password” or account not recognized.
- Diagnosis: Check caps lock; ensure you are on the correct regional site (e.g., .com, .eu, .au). If using the bitstarz app (PWA), clear the site data/cache for Bitstarz in your browser settings and relaunch.
- Resolution: Use “Forgot Password” function. If problem persists, your IP may be geo-blocked; check with a VPN (only if legal).
- Scenario 2: Delayed Crypto Deposit.
- Symptom: Transaction not credited after 30+ minutes.
- Diagnosis: Check blockchain explorer (e.g., blockchain.com for BTC) using your wallet’s transaction ID (TXID). Confirm network has sufficient confirmations. Ensure you sent to the correct, newly generated address from Bitstarz (addresses can expire).
- Resolution: If confirmed on-chain but not credited, contact support with the TXID.
- Scenario 3: Game Loading Error.
- Symptom: Game fails to load, shows black screen, or freezes.
- Diagnosis: Typically a local client-side issue: outdated browser, corrupted cache, or insufficient bandwidth.
- Resolution: Clear browser cache; disable browser extensions (ad-blockers especially); try a different browser; switch from Wi-Fi to mobile data or vice-versa.
Extended FAQ: Technical & Operational Queries
Q1: Is the Bitstarz app safe to install from my browser?
A: Yes. A PWA installation is essentially a secured bookmark. It does not request intrusive permissions like a native app might. The security layer remains the TLS-encrypted browser connection.
Q2: How does the “Provably Fair” system actually work?
A: Before your bet, the server generates a secret seed. You can provide a client seed. The combination of these seeds and a nonce (bet number) creates a hash. After the bet, you can reveal the server seed, verify the hash was not altered, and recalculate the game outcome to confirm it was deterministic and fair.
Q3: What happens if I forget to use my bonus code during registration?
A: Most welcome bonuses are automatically applied to the first deposit if you meet the minimum. However, for specific promotional codes, you must enter them in the cashier before depositing. Contact support immediately after deposit if you forgot; they may credit it manually.
Q4: Are there any hidden fees for cryptocurrency withdrawals?
A: Bitstarz does not charge a fee. However, the blockchain network (e.g., Bitcoin network) charges a miner fee. This fee is deducted from the amount you send, so you will receive slightly less than the withdrawal amount in your external wallet.
Q5: Can I use a VPN to access Bitstarz?
A: It is strongly discouraged and against their Terms. Using a VPN to circumvent geo-restrictions will trigger security alerts. If detected, your account may be suspended and funds confiscated. Only access from a legal jurisdiction without a VPN.
Q6: Why is my withdrawal pending for so long?
A: Fiat withdrawals undergo manual processing and security checks, taking 1-48 hours. Crypto withdrawals are usually instant but can be delayed during security reviews or system maintenance. Check your email for verification requests.
Q7: What is the difference between “Bonus Balance” and “Real Balance”?
A: They are segregated wallets. Bonus funds (with wagering requirements) are in the Bonus Balance. Your own deposited money and winnings from it are in the Real Balance. You usually wager from the Bonus Balance first. You cannot withdraw from the Bonus Balance until its WR is met.
Q8: My account is verified, but I’m asked for KYC again on a large withdrawal. Why?
A> This is standard enhanced due diligence. Large withdrawals may trigger an additional layer of source of funds (SOF) checks to comply with anti-money laundering (AML) regulations. Cooperate promptly to expedite the process.
Q9: Can I change my registered currency after account creation?
A: No. The currency (USD, EUR, BTC, etc.) is locked upon registration. To use a different currency, you must create a new account, subject to the one-account-per-household rule.
Q10: The game crashed mid-spin. Is my bet lost?
A> No. Modern casino game servers maintain a transaction log. Reload the game. It will either reconnect to the interrupted round or show the result. If your balance is incorrect, contact support with the game name, time, and your username for a manual check.
Conclusion
Bitstarz presents a sophisticated, hybrid gambling ecosystem that rewards technical understanding. Success on the platform is not merely a matter of luck but of strategic decision-making regarding bonuses, a preference for the efficiency of cryptocurrency transactions, and competent navigation of its digital infrastructure, primarily through its PWA-based bitstarz app. By internalizing the mathematical models for bonuses, adhering to security best practices like enabling 2FA for your bitstarz login, and understanding the troubleshooting protocols for common issues, users can engage with the platform from a position of informed confidence. This guide serves as a foundational technical manual for optimizing your operational and strategic approach to one of the industry’s most innovative casinos.
